package tree
import (
"testing"
"github.com/stretchr/testify/assert"
)
func TestNodeEquals(t *testing.T) {
n1 := Node{Name: "node1", Leaf: true}
n2 := Node{Name: "node1", Leaf: true}
n3 := Node{Name: "node2", Leaf: false}
assert.True(t, n1.Equals(n2))
assert.False(t, n1.Equals(n3))
}
func TestNodeMerge(t *testing.T) {
n1 := Node{Name: "node1", Leaf: true, Template: true}
n2 := Node{Name: "node1", Leaf: false, Template: false, Mount: true, Path: "/mnt"}
merged := n1.Merge(n2)
assert.Equal(t, "node1", merged.Name)
assert.False(t, merged.Leaf)
assert.False(t, merged.Template)
assert.True(t, merged.Mount)
assert.Equal(t, "/mnt", merged.Path)
}
func TestNodeFormat(t *testing.T) {
n := Node{Name: "node1", Leaf: true}
expected := "└── node1\n"
result := n.format("", true, INF, 0)
assert.Equal(t, expected, result)
}
func TestNodeLen(t *testing.T) {
n := Node{Name: "node1", Leaf: true}
assert.Equal(t, 1, n.Len())
subtree := &Tree{Nodes: []*Node{{Name: "child1", Leaf: true}, {Name: "child2", Leaf: true}}}
n.Subtree = subtree
assert.Equal(t, 3, n.Len())
}
func TestNodeList(t *testing.T) {
n := Node{Name: "node1", Leaf: true}
expected := []string{"node1"}
result := n.list("", INF, 0, true)
assert.Equal(t, expected, result)
subtree := &Tree{Nodes: []*Node{{Name: "child1", Leaf: true}, {Name: "child2", Leaf: true}}}
n.Subtree = subtree
expected = []string{"node1", "node1/child1", "node1/child2"}
result = n.list("", INF, 0, true)
assert.Equal(t, expected, result)
}
